Gail Vernell Teegarden, 63, of Rossville, passed away Friday, June 15, 2018 at Carle Foundation Hospital, Urbana, Illinois.
Gail was born on April 17, 1955, in Great Lakes, Illinois, the daughter of Edward and Joanne (Wilson) Zientek. She married Daniel Teegarden on May 20, 1995 in Cheneyville, Illinois.
She is survived survived by her husband- Daniel Teegarden of Rossville; two daughters- Ruby Andaracua of Manassas, Virginia and Kayla Teegarden of Rossville; four grandchildren; two brothers- Edward Zientek of Champaign, Illinois and Martin Zientek of Mahomet; a nephew and a niece.
She was preceded in death by his parents.
Gail graduated from Central High School in Champaign, Illinois. She worked as a housekeeper at The Chancellor Hotel, in Champaign, Illinois. She enjoyed attending flea markets and was an avid rock music lover. She enjoyed listening to Billy Idol, KISS, Prince and Kid Rock. Gail enjoyed spending time with her family.
Funeral Services will be held at 10:00 a.m. Wednesday, June 20, 2018, at Blurton Funeral Home, Hoopeston, Illinois. Pastor John Morris will be officiating. Graveside service will follow at Rossville Cemetery. Visitation will be held from 4-7:00 p.m. on Tuesday June 19, 2018 at the funeral home.
